Abstract
The utility model discloses an over -and -under type iron stand platform has solved and need become flexible the problem that the bracket comes height -adjusting when doing the experiment. Its characterized in that: install the sleeve on the pillar, the sleeve can be followed the pillar slides from top to bottom, the bracket is fixed on the sleeve, still install on the base and be used for adjusting the adjusting device of sleeve height. The utility model discloses the bracket is installed on the sleeve, passes through adjusting device adjusting sleeve's height when doing the experiment, guarantees the height of bracket, need not not hard up bracket and comes height -adjusting.

Specific embodiment
The utility model is described in further detail with embodiment below in conjunction with the accompanying drawings:
In embodiment, as shown in figure 1, a kind of lift iron stand, including base 1, described base 1 is provided with pillar 2, institute
State and adjustable for height bracket 3 is provided with pillar, described pillar 2 is provided with sleeve 4, described sleeve 4 can be along along described pillar 2
Lower slider, described bracket 3 is fixed on described sleeve 4, described base 1 is also equipped with for adjusting described sleeve 4 height
Adjusting means.Described bracket is arranged on sleeve, passes through the height of adjusting means regulating sleeve, to ensure bracket when testing
Height it is ensured that experiment safety.
In embodiment, as shown in Fig. 1, described base 1 is provided with rotatable screw mandrel 5, and described screw mandrel 5 is flat with described pillar 2
OK, described screw mandrel 5 is threaded with nut 6, described nut 6 is connected by a connector 7 with described sleeve 4, described silk
Bar 5 and nut 6 constitute described adjusting means.Screw nut driving is sensitive steadily, precision stability good it can be ensured that the number tested
According to accurate.
In embodiment, as shown in Fig. 1, described screw mandrel 5 is provided with a gear 8, and described base 1 is provided with installing rack 9, described
Installing rack 9 is provided with No. two gears 10 engaging with a described gear 8, and the crank driving described No. two gears 10 rotation
11.Gear drive is steady, gear ratio is accurate, transmission efficiency, long service life.
In embodiment, as shown in figure 1, the diameter with diameter greater than a gear 8 of described No. two gears 10.Described No. two teeth
Wheel 10 turns around, and that a gear 8 just can be driven to turn around is above, improves work efficiency, also time saving and energy saving for operator.
In embodiment, as shown in Fig. 1, a described gear 8 and No. two gears 10 are bevel gear.It is arranged on knot on base 1
Structure is compacter.
In embodiment, as shown in Fig. 1, described pillar 2 top is connected by No. two connectors 12 with screw mandrel 5 top.Protect
Stability and the collimation of screw mandrel 5 and pillar 2 are demonstrate,proved.
In embodiment, as shown in Fig. 1, described base 1 is provided with a bearing 13, is provided with described No. two connectors 12
No. two bearings 14, described screw mandrel 5 is arranged between a described bearing 13 and No. two bearings 14.Bearing not only acts as fixing screw mandrel
5 effect, but also have the characteristics that resistance to sliding is little.
In embodiment, as shown in Fig. 1, described screw mandrel 5 is self-locking screw mandrel.When the preponderance on bracket it is ensured that bracket
Will not fall down.
In embodiment, as shown in Fig. 2, described bracket 3 is provided with supporting plate 15, and described supporting plate 15 bottom is provided with circular protrusions
, described bracket 3 one end is notched annulus, and described circular protrusions are arranged in described annulus.Described bracket 3 and supporting plate 15 are torn open
Unload conveniently, described circular protrusions are arranged in described annulus with diameter greater than described circle diameter, described circular protrusions, make annulus
Breach opens, and to ensure described annulus clamping circular protrusions.
Described base 1 side is provided with least one magnet piece 16.The adsorbable bracket 3 of described magnet piece 16, prevents from finishing reality
Test, unload the problem generation that bottom bracket 3 can not find because leaving about or loses.
